GREEN v. ALASKA NAT. INS. CO.

No. 99-C-2844.

759 So.2d 165 (2000)

Leonard GREEN v. ALASKA NATIONAL INSURANCE COMPANY, Rowan Companies, Inc. and Universal Services.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, Fourth Circuit.

Writ Denied June 2, 2000.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John H. Denenea, Jr., Jonathan M. Walsh, Wiedemann & Wiedemann, New Orleans, Louisiana, Counsel for Plaintiff/Relator.

Grady S. Hurley, L. Etienne Balart, Jones, Walker, Waechter, Poitevent, Carrere & Denegre, L.L.P., New Orleans, LA, Counsel for Defendant/Respondents.

(Court composed of Judge JOAN BERNARD ARMSTRONG, Judge MOON LANDRIEU, Judge JAMES F. McKAY, III, Judge MICHAEL E. KIRBY and Judge ROBERT A. KATZ).


ARMSTRONG, Judge.

We agree with the trial court's determination that venue is not proper in Orleans Parish and, therefore, we will affirm that part of the judgment. However, we feel that dismissal with prejudice is not warranted in this case and that an order of transfer to a parish of proper venue is more appropriate.
